Dividend Safety Rating
GPK's dividend appears safe and well-supported. Strengths include a 47.8% earnings payout ratio & 13.5% cfo payout ratio. Areas of concern: 85.0% fcf payout ratio & 4.1% operating margin. The dividend has been growing at a 7.96% 5-year CAGR.
Based on 15 of 15 metrics
Strengths
- Earnings Payout Ratio: 47.8%Low earnings payout ratio leaves room to grow the dividend.
- CFO Payout Ratio: 13.5%Operating cash flow strongly supports the payout.
- Dividend Streak: 11+ yrsLong, uninterrupted dividend track record.
Risks
- FCF Payout Ratio: 85.0%Free cash flow is tight relative to the dividend.
- Operating Margin: 4.1%Operating margin is thin and pressures the dividend.
- Gross Margin: 14.2%Gross margin is low and limits flexibility.

Graphic Packaging Holding Company is a leading provider in the packaging industry, specializing in sustainable fiber-based solutions. It primarily produces paperboard packaging, which plays a critical role in protecting, preserving, and marketing products for consumer brands. Catering to a variety of sectors, including food and beverage, household goods, and personal care, the company serves high-profile end markets with customized packaging solutions tailored to specific client needs. Notable for its commitment to sustainability, Graphic Packaging emphasizes recycling and environmentally friendly practices throughout its production processes. Headquartered in Atlanta, Georgia, the company operates state-of-the-art facilities worldwide, supporting a global supply chain.
